本文主要是介绍【解题报告】Educational Codeforces Round 13,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!
题目链接
A. Johny Likes Numbers(Codeforces 678A)
思路
首先直接枚举 k 的倍数是不可能的,数据规模告诉我们必须通过直接计算得到结果。下面分类,当
代码
#include <bits/stdc++.h>
using namespace std;typedef long long ll;
ll n, k, tmp;int main() {cin >> n >> k;tmp = n % k;if(tmp == 0) {cout << n + k << endl;}else {cout << n - tmp + k << endl;}return 0;
}
B. The Same Calendar(Codeforces 678B)
思路
首先想象下面的场景,我们将今年的每月分的日历拼接起来形成年历,然后将从今年开始后的 4000 年的年历拼接起来形成一份超长的年历。因为 365mod7=2
这篇关于【解题报告】Educational Codeforces Round 13的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!